מה זה CD?
זהו פריסה רציפה של קוד בסביבות ייצור.
הגדרה
פריסה רציפה (Continuous Deployment), או Continuous Delivery, היא גישה להנדסת תוכנה שבה שינויים בקוד משתחררים אוטומטית לסביבת הייצור דרך סדרת בדיקות אוטומטיות.
תהליך
שינויים חדשים בקוד עוברים צינור בדיקות ובחינות, ואם הם מאושרים, הם משוחררים ישירות לסביבת הייצור.
יתרונות
הפריסה הרציפה מאיצה את אספקת התוכנה, מקטינה את הזמן להוצאה לשוק של תכונות חדשות, ומאפשרת מחזורי פידבק מהירים יותר.
תיקון בעיות
פריסות תכופות מקלות על גילוי ותיקון בעיות, מכיוון שהבעיות חדשות יותר וקל יותר לאתר אותן.